# Local imports
from . import Queue, QueueStatus, QueueType


# A queue which pushes element artifacts
#
class PushQueue(Queue):

    action_name = "Push"
    complete_name = "Pushed"
    queue_type = QueueType.PUSH

    def process(self, element):
        # returns whether an artifact was uploaded or not
        return element._push()

    def status(self, element):
        if element._skip_push():
            return QueueStatus.SKIP

        return QueueStatus.READY

    def done(self, element, result, success):

        if not success:
            return False

        # Element._push() returns True if it uploaded an artifact,
        # here we want to appear skipped if the remote already had
        # the artifact.
        return result
